Subject: Quickstore 4.2 — bloom filter now fronts the KV layer

Plugin authors: starting with this release, Quickstore places a bloom filter ahead of the key-value store. Negative lookups return faster; false positives fall through safely. No API changes are required on your side. Verify your plugin against the staging build referenced below.

session token of fahif-tadup = htk3_9c7

Finance Review — Product-Line Retirement. The Brindlewick Classic range will be retired at the end of Q2. Remaining stock is to be cleared through standard markdown tiers; no branch-level exceptions. Margin impact this quarter is modest and already booked. Supplier contracts have been wound down without penalty. Direct customer questions to the standard script. Strategic context is noted below.

management briefing: Project Ulavan slips by two quarters because of the staffing delay.

Managers-Only Wiki — Warranty Cost Overrun: Durnmark Chillers

Warranty claims on the Durnmark chiller line ran forty percent over budget this half. Root cause: compressor seal batch from the Arlow facility. Replacement stock secured; field-swap programme underway across all branches. Do not discuss figures with distributors. Claims processing continues as normal pending the recall review. Branch-level implications follow from the confidential plans noted below.

internal memo for yahag-tahog: The pricing group signed off on a budget of $152.8 million for Project Soriel.

Hey — noticed during the release dry-run that the Splitwing A/B assignment service in prod no longer matches what's in the repo. Someone hand-edited the bucketing salt rotation and sticky-session TTL back in March and never committed it, so staging and prod now assign users differently for the same experiment keys. That's a real problem for the Lanternfish experiment analysis. Before we cut the next release, we should reconcile. For reference, here's what prod is actually running right now.

service settings:
WENATH_PIN=5007
WENATH_METRICS_HOST=metrics.wenath.tolvaqlabs.corp
WENATH_LOG_LEVEL=debug
WENATH_TENANT=rusox